4.5/5 stars (26 reviews) • Video > Interactive Courses
Basic Audio Programming
Save 34% • Offer expires May 10th
Get Your Discount
💡 Pricing Note: The prices shown here are based on Plugin Boutique’s listed rate at time of publishing. Your local currency and exact discount percentage may vary depending on your region — click through to see the price in your currency before purchasing.
If you’ve ever wondered how audio plugins actually work under the hood, Basic Audio Programming offers a clear, hands-on entry point. Developed by Dr Chris Nash from pointblank Music School in association with The Audio Programmer, this focused 4-hour mini course teaches you to build real-time audio plugins in C++—no prior coding experience needed. You’ll start with a simple gain effect, then progress through clipping distortion, subtractive synthesis, and finally a JP8000-inspired SuperSaw synth capable of classic trance textures.
What sets this course apart is its bespoke virtual learning environment, built specifically for audio programming education. You’ll work inside Klang Studio, a C++ IDE that runs directly in your DAW, letting you code and hear results in real time. Every practical step includes video demonstrations and audio commentary, while over 60 custom animations break down complex DSP and coding concepts into digestible visual explanations. Interactive browser-based exercises reinforce key ideas without requiring local setup hassles.
The curriculum mirrors a taster version of pointblank’s BSc (Hons) Music Production and Software Engineering degree, structured into 12 bite-sized lessons across four progressive modules. You’ll learn how audio is represented as data, apply conditional statements for signal shaping, code objects for synth architecture, and use arrays and loops to layer detuned oscillators. By the end, you’ll have four functional plugins you built yourself—and a solid foundation to pursue professional audio software development.
The first module is available to try free, so you can explore the teaching style and platform before committing. Whether you’re a producer curious about coding or a developer exploring DSP, this course meets you where you are and guides you toward tangible, creative outcomes.
Key Features
Visual
- Over 60 custom animations that explain audio and coding concepts visually
- Video demonstrations with audio commentary for every practical step
Control
- Interactive browser-based coding exercises to explore DSP concepts safely
- Live C++ plugin development inside your DAW using Klang Studio (Mac/PC)
Processing
- Build four real-time audio plugins: Gain, Distortion, Subtractive Synth, and SuperSaw
- Learn core DSP techniques: signal representation, clipping, envelope shaping, filtering, and oscillator layering
Workflow
- 12 bite-sized lessons organized into 4 progressive, project-based modules
- Bespoke digital learning platform designed specifically for audio programming education
System Compatibility
- MacOS (10.15 Catalina or higher) or Windows (10 or higher)
- Audio interface (soundcard) and speakers/headphones
- Modern browser: Chrome, Edge, Firefox, or Safari
Basic Audio Programming
34% Off — $22.99 USDfrom $34.99 USD
Claim 34% Off Deal⏰ Offer ends May 10
💡 Pricing Note: The prices shown here are based on Plugin Boutique’s listed rate at time of publishing. Your local currency and exact discount percentage may vary depending on your region — click through to see the price in your currency before purchasing.












